Output 666caabd1362cd3b68f715145b1ba8d2135707c045e262be08f498d3ed341bfd:0

value
25386017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c44bf0f25d9272af16be81c3eeb80b8fbabd1e6 OP_EQUAL
address
3D264ugXWL5a9w9oy571nTtH9R9Xy615bh
transaction
666caabd1362cd3b68f715145b1ba8d2135707c045e262be08f498d3ed341bfd
spent
true